Harnessing the potential of unstructured healthcare data

80% of healthcare data is unstructured today.
Unstructured data serves a critical purpose, but it cannot be
pigeonholed. And when billions of patients are concerned, the very
nature of unstructured data gives way to inefficient care on a grand
scale.
3. According to a survey by HIMSS Media, 56% of healthcare
professionals cited unstructured data as a key barrier to optimizing
clinical workflows.
Structured data in spreadsheets and relational databases are
presented in a way that facilitates easier search and analysis. It is
functional. But unstructured data in handwritten prescriptions and
pathology reports defy rigid rules and systems to convey a deeper
awareness of a patient’s condition. It can be insightful.
4. The Dichotomy of Structured and
Unstructured Data
The importance of both kinds of data depends on how they are
managed. Structured data lends itself to the organization and
mechanical analysis, a task befitting most current systems. Imagine a
spreadsheet sprawling with names, dates, heights, weights, currencies,
blood types, diagnostic codes, and many more values.
Such data is mandatory for insurance companies in the event of
reimbursement claims. Its management is more straightforward and
requires little human intervention.
5. However, structured data has clinical value as it is backed by
unstructured data. The problem lies in the inability of typical analytic
solutions to analyze this data since it exists in the form of free text and
narrative. Here’s a hypothetical situation at a clinic:

8. A 130/80 level of blood pressure and the prescribed diuretic can fit neatly in a spreadsheet.
But the recommendations of meditation and spending more time at home cannot. The
forthcoming X-ray report won’t find a place either. Yet it is those bits of information that reveal
a lot more about the patient’s current and future state of health than a single blood pressure
level or a medication. Both these facts might be specific to the patient but are also generic in
the information they convey.
A study in the Journal of the American Medical Informatics Association (JAMIA) states that
real-world data in electronic health records (EHRs) provide more accuracy, but only when it is
mined by trained algorithms. The study found that with structured EHR data, the average
precision and recall were 98.3% and 51.7% respectively. With unstructured data, the
corresponding rates were 95.3% and 95.5%.
